Psalm 94:12

Blessed is the man whom you discipline, Yah, and teach out of your law;

Job 5:17

"Behold, happy is the man whom God corrects. Therefore do not despise the chastening of the Almighty.

Psalm 119:71

It is good for me that I have been afflicted, that I may learn your statutes.

1 Corinthians 11:32

But when we are judged, we are punished by the Lord, that we may not be condemned with the world.

Deuteronomy 8:5

You shall consider in your heart that as a man chastens his son, so Yahweh your God chastens you.

Job 33:16-25

Then he opens the ears of men, and seals their instruction,

Psalm 119:67

Before I was afflicted, I went astray; but now I observe your word.

Proverbs 3:11-12

My son, don't despise Yahweh's discipline, neither be weary of his reproof:

Micah 6:9

Yahweh's voice calls to the city, and wisdom sees your name: "Listen to the rod, and he who appointed it.

Hebrews 12:5-11

and you have forgotten the exhortation which reasons with you as with children, "My son, don't take lightly the chastening of the Lord, nor faint when you are reproved by him;

Revelation 3:19

As many as I love, I reprove and chasten. Be zealous therefore, and repent.
